关于浮动菜单在点击以前自动隐藏的问题

作div浮动菜单,须要在点击菜单项以后再消失整个菜单,可是若是简单在外层div中设置onblur的话,就会在内层菜单触发点击以前隐藏掉整个菜单致使点击不生效。html 简单搜索了一下,大概有设置全屏透明层和在内层的onmousedown里设置preventDefault的方法。可是若是用React或vue之类的框架,有一种不知道算是简单仍是复杂的方法,即在外层菜单同时设置onfocus和onblu
相关文章
相关标签/搜索